16 /*
17 * Get size of a device path.
18 *
19 * This function implements the GetDevicePathSize service of the device path
20 * utilities protocol. The device path length includes the end of path tag
21 * which may be an instance end.
22 *
23 * See the Unified Extensible Firmware Interface (UEFI) specification
24 * for details.
25 *
26 * @device_path device path
27 * Return: size in bytes
28 */
get_device_path_size(const struct efi_device_path * device_path)29 static efi_uintn_t EFIAPI get_device_path_size(
30 const struct efi_device_path *device_path)
31 {
32 efi_uintn_t sz = 0;
33
34 EFI_ENTRY("%pD", device_path);
35 /* size includes the EFI_DP_END node: */
36 if (device_path)
37 sz = efi_dp_size(device_path) + sizeof(struct efi_device_path);
38 return EFI_EXIT(sz);
39 }
40
41 /*
42 * Duplicate a device path.
43 *
44 * This function implements the DuplicateDevicePath service of the device path
45 * utilities protocol.
46 *
47 * The UEFI spec does not indicate what happens to the end tag. We follow the
48 * EDK2 logic: In case the device path ends with an end of instance tag, the
49 * copy will also end with an end of instance tag.
50 *
51 * See the Unified Extensible Firmware Interface (UEFI) specification
52 * for details.
53 *
54 * @device_path device path
55 * Return: copy of the device path
56 */
duplicate_device_path(const struct efi_device_path * device_path)57 static struct efi_device_path * EFIAPI duplicate_device_path(
58 const struct efi_device_path *device_path)
59 {
60 EFI_ENTRY("%pD", device_path);
61 return EFI_EXIT(efi_dp_dup(device_path));
62 }
